This program offers fun soccer classes specifically designed for children between the ages of 4 and 5 years old. This is a fantastic way to introduce children to the sport of soccer while also promoting physical activity, coordination, teamwork, and confidence. Meeting point

Meet under the gum trees near Gilchrist Avenue and the Herston Busway station entrance. Parking is best along Gilchrist Avenue.
